News24xx.com - The wedding of Prince Harry and Meghan Markle become a hot topic worldwide. It is one of the most important royal events that ever happened. If you look closely, you will see how the female guests were wearing hats to the wedding.

 

For some of us, wearing hats during a formal event will seem weird. However, it is not for British royal family.

 

British female royals are required to wear hats during formal events. It has become an obligatory accessory. Not only female members of the royal family, the other female guests also have to wear hat to be able to be accepted as guests.
 

This tradition of wearing hats for royal family has been enacted for centuries. Hat is an accessory that is used to cover your hair.

 

Wearing hats to cover your hair becomes symbol humility
 

This tradition had disappeared once during 1950s, although the women still wear hats during special occasions, such as visiting the church. The tradition then continued. The female members of British royal family are required to cover their heads during formal events. So of course whenever there is a royal event, all the female guests will be seen wearing hats.
